Administrative Specialist III
Clallam County, WA
The Administrative Specialist III performs complex administrative, fiscal, technical, and program support functions for the Parks, Fair & Facilities Department. Serving as a primary point of contact for the public, staff, vendors, and other agencies, this position provides day-to-day office coordination, customer service, records management, payroll, accounts payable and receivable, revenue tracking, and other financial support. Working under general supervision, the position exercises independent judgment in interpreting and applying policies, procedures, regulations, and established work methods to address routine to complex administrative and operational matters. The position coordinates departmental administrative processes and specialized programs, including public records, online reservations, special occasion permits, campground services, memorial bench and table requests, and Parks Advisory Board support. Responsibilities include preparing reports and financial information, assisting with budget development and monitoring, processing contracts and Board of County Commissioners materials, coordinating meetings and projects, maintaining confidential records and databases, supporting hiring and onboarding, and preparing required tax and financial reports. The position also provides technical guidance and training to staff, serves as a liaison with County departments, vendors, regulatory agencies, and community members, and conducts research and analysis to support management decisions and recommend improvements to departmental operations. Requires knowledge of the field of assignment sufficient to perform thoroughly and accurately the full scope of responsibility as illustrated by examples in the above job description. Education Associate’s degree (AA) or equivalent from an accredited college or university, with major coursework in Business Management, Public Administration, or a closely related field. In lieu of the Associate’s degree, an additional two (2) years of directly related experience may substitute for the education requirement. Experience Minimum five years of related experience in progressively responsible positions providing administrative and/or fiscal support, preferably within a local governmental or public-sector entity. Demonstrated attention to detail in written and verbal communications. Proficiency with Windows-based software and Microsoft Office applications, including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int, as well as internet and database applications. Experience compiling, organizing, and preparing reports to address operational needs and inquiries. Demonstrated ability to organize work, respond effectively to changing priorities, and manage multiple responsibilities.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with coworkers, other departments, partner agencies, and members of the public. #J-18808-Ljbffr Clallam County, WA
